Why Hands-On Safety Training is Critical
While reading about safety protocols and regulations is necessary, it doesn’t provide the practical experience needed to handle real-world hazards. Hands-on safety training goes a step further by equipping workers with real skills in a controlled environment that mirrors actual workplace conditions. This type of training allows workers to actively engage with equipment, safety procedures, and emergency scenarios, helping build muscle memory and boosting confidence.
Consider the example of a construction worker. Rather than simply learning how to operate heavy machinery by reading manuals, they learn to operate it in a training setting under controlled conditions, simulating failures and emergencies. This practical experience develops instinctive responses, which are crucial in emergencies when prompt decision-making is required.
Additionally, OSHA (Occupational Safety and Health Administration) studies indicate that companies that incorporate hands-on training into their safety programs see a significant reduction in workplace accidents—sometimes as much as 30%. This improves safety and boosts employee morale, reduces injuries, and creates a more productive and efficient workforce.
Key Benefits of Hands-On Training
1. Better Retention of Safety Procedures
The primary benefit of hands-on training is improved retention. Engaging in realistic simulations helps workers retain safety protocols more effectively, leading to better performance in high-pressure situations. By practicing in a controlled environment, workers develop the muscle memory and decision-making skills necessary to respond confidently in emergencies.
2. Enhanced Decision-Making Skills
Practical safety training doesn’t just teach workers the right actions to take—it also sharpens their decision-making skills. Employees can practice making decisions in real time, under pressure, through hands-on training. They learn to assess a situation, recognize hazards, and decide the best course of action, often with little time to think.
Scenario-based exercises help workers develop a proactive mindset. This builds confidence and improves their ability to make quick and accurate decisions in dangerous situations.
3. Improved Regulatory Compliance
In addition to making the workplace safer, hands-on training ensures compliance with OSHA regulations. OSHA mandates that certain industries provide specific types of safety training for employees. Hands-on training sessions enable companies to meet these standards more effectively while fostering an environment where employees are more likely to follow safety procedures correctly.
By regularly conducting hands-on training, companies reduce the risk of failing safety audits, facing penalties, or experiencing workplace accidents that could result in costly lawsuits.

The Role of Technology in Safety Training
While hands-on training is vital, emerging technologies also play an important role in enhancing safety. Virtual Reality (VR) and Augmented Reality (AR) have made it possible for workers to train in lifelike simulations without exposing them to real-world risks. For example, workers in high-risk environments, such as mining or construction, can practice navigating complex machinery or responding to emergencies using VR technology.
How VR and AR Benefit Safety Training:
-
Risk-free environment: Employees can engage in hazardous scenarios without the risk of injury.
-
Repeatable simulations: Workers can practice dangerous situations multiple times until they feel confident in their abilities.
-
Realistic scenarios: VR and AR simulate scenarios that are difficult to replicate in the real world, such as confined-space rescues or large-scale chemical spills.
As these technologies continue to improve, the ability to offer immersive learning experiences that mirror actual conditions will become even more accessible and cost-effective.
Techniques for High-Risk Job Safety
In addition to hands-on training, several techniques can be employed to further enhance safety in high-risk environments. These techniques complement hands-on experiences and create a comprehensive approach to workplace safety.
1. Scenario-Based Training
Scenario-based training allows workers to face emergencies in a controlled setting, such as responding to a chemical leak or machinery breakdown. These exercises help workers develop critical thinking and decision-making skills that will serve them well in real-life emergencies.
2. Mentorship Programs
Pairing inexperienced workers with seasoned professionals in a mentorship program ensures that new employees benefit from hands-on learning in real time. Mentors can provide practical advice and offer insights based on their years of experience, helping to instill a safety-oriented mindset in the next generation of workers.
3. Regular Safety Drills
Just as schools conduct fire drills, workplaces should conduct regular safety drills to reinforce quick reactions in emergencies. These drills should be frequent, consistent, and as realistic as possible to ensure that employees are always prepared to respond efficiently to dangerous situations.

Equipping Employees for Hazardous Tasks
High-risk jobs present unique challenges where the unexpected can occur at any time. Workers who have undergone hands-on training are better prepared for these challenges.
For example, electricians who undergo hands-on training, including live-wire exercises, are better equipped to manage electrical faults and respond quickly in emergencies. Similarly, welders who practice under varying conditions are more likely to handle unexpected complications effectively.
This type of training creates a workforce that is well-prepared and highly skilled, ready to take on the demanding tasks required in high-risk jobs.
